El Paso Gas Pipeline

El Paso Gas Pipeline is an operating gas transmission pipeline in United States. The tracker lists 1 tracked segment, 16,319 km long and 57.23 bcm/y of capacity, starting up in 1997. It runs from Texas to California. It is owned by Kinder Morgan Inc.
